Portamento Control
status
2nd byte
3rd byte
BnH
54H
kkH
kk = Source Note Number: 00H - 7FH (C-1 - G9)
* A Note On message received immediately after a Portamento control will be sounded
with the pitch changing smoothly from the source note number.
* If a voice is already sounding at the same note number as the source note number, that
voice will change pitch to the pitch of the newly received Note On, and continue
sounding (i.e., will be played legato).

* The speed of the pitch change caused by Portamento is determined by the
PORTAMENTO TIME parameter value.

Program Change
status
2nd byte
CnH
ppH
pp=Program number: 00H - 7FH (prog.1 - prog.128)
* Regardless of the Tx/Rx ProgChg SW ([MIDI]) setting, this message is received if the
system parameter Remote KBD CH ([MIDI]) is ALL or if the MIDI channel of the
program change matches.
* When this is received, a performance change will occur if [PERFORM/PATCH
SELECT] is off (PERFORM). If [PERFORM/PATCH SELECT] is on (PATCH), the patch
will change for the part selected by PANEL SELECT.
* In the case of a performance change, program numbers outside the range of 00H - 3FH
will be ignored.
* When this message is received, all voices will be turned off.
Channel Pressure
status
2nd byte
DnH
vvH
* This is received only when Remote KBD CH ([MIDI]) is ALL or if the MIDI channel of
the channel pressure matches.
* When Tx/Rx Edit SW ([MIDI]) is ON and Tx/Rx Edit Mode ([MIDI]) is set to MODE2,
the Tx/Rx Setting ([MIDI]) will be valid. In this case, the message will change the value
of the parameter which is assigned to AFTERTOUCH for the part specified by PANEL
SELECT. At the same time, a channel pressure message will be transmitted from MIDI
OUT on the Part MIDI CH ([PART]) of that part.
* If Control Up/Control Down ([MIDI]) is set to AFTERTOUCH, this message will
function as controller up or down for the part specified by PANEL SELECT (if KEY
MODE is SINGLE or SPLIT), or for both Upper and Lower parts regardless of the
PANEL SELECT setting (if KEY MODE is DUAL). With the factory settings, Control
Up is set to AFTERTOUCH. At the same time, channel pressure messages will be
transmitted from MIDI OUT on the Part MIDI CH ([PART]) of that part.

Pitch Bend Change
status
2nd byte
3rd byte
EnH
llH
mmH
mm,ll=Pitch Bend value:
00 00H - 40 00H - 7F 7FH (-8192 - 0 - +8191)
* This is received only when Remote KBD CH ([MIDI]) is ALL or when the MIDI
channel of the Pitch Bend Change matches.
* Pitch bend change messages that are received will modify the pitch of the part
specified by PANEL SELECT (if KEY MODE is SINGLE or SPLIT) or of both Upper
and Lower parts regardless of the PANEL SELECT setting (if KEY MODE is DUAL).
At the same time, pitch bend change messages will be transmitted from MIDI OUT on
the Part MIDI CH ([PART]) for that part.
* The range of pitch change will be according to the patch parameter Bend Range Up
([PATCH]) and Bend Range Down ([PATCH]). Pitch bend values in the range of 00
00H - 3F 7FH will apply according to Bend Range Down, and values in the range of 40
01H - 7F 7FH will apply according to Bend Range Up.
Channel Mode messages
Reset All Controllers (Controller number 121)
status
2nd byte
3rd byte
BnH
79H
00H
* This is received only when Remote KBD CH ([MIDI]) is ALL or when the MIDI
channel of the Reset All Controllers matches.
* When this message is received, the values of the following controllers will be reset for
the part selected by PANEL SELECT if KEY MODE is SINGLE or SPLIT, or for both
Upper and Lower parts regardless of the PANEL SELECT setting if KEY MODE is
DUAL.

All Note Off
status
2nd byte
3rd byte
BnH
7BH
00H
* This is received only when Remote KBD CH ([MIDI]) is ALL or when the MIDI
channel of the All Note Off matches.
* When this message is received, all notes of the part specified by PANEL SELECT
which are currently on will be turned off. However if Hold 1 is on, the sound will
continue until this is turned off.

Mono
status
2nd byte
3rd byte
BnH
7EH
mmH
mm=Mono number:
00H - 10H (0 - 16)
* This is received only when Remote KBD CH ([MIDI]) is ALL or when the MIDI
channel of the Mono message matches.
* The mono number is always handled as 1.
* The same processing will be performed as when All Note Off is received, and [MONO]
will be turned on for the patch of the part specified by PANEL SELECT.
